Test No. 109: Density of Liquids and Solids
This Test Guideline lists methods for determining the density of liquids and solids, giving only a very succinct description of them. The density of a substance is the quotient of its mass and its volume and is expressed in kg/m3. Several methods are for liquid substance only: hydrometer, immersed body method (both are buoyancy methods) and oscillating densitometer. These methods are applicable to liquids with a dynamic viscosity below 5 Pa s for hydrometer and oscillating densitometer and below 20 Pa s for immersed body method. The method for solids only is the air comparison pycnometer. The volume of a sample of the solid is measured in air or in an inert gas in a calibrated cylinder of variable volume. After concluding the volume measurement, the sample is weighed. The methods for liquids and solids are the hydrostatic balance (a buoyancy method) and the pycnometer.
